Edwardian Walnut Marble Top Wash Stand

1900 - 1920
Description

Edwardian walnut marble top wash stand , the base with two cupboard doors , standing om taper legs with casters. There is a black and white veined marble slab, with a marble splash back . The back with shaped sides and a oval swing bevel mirror.

Physical Dimensions
Height
150cm (59.06")
Width
107cm (42.13")
Depth
48cm (18.90")

An Edwardian marble top washstand is a piece of bedroom or dressing room cabinet furniture produced between 1901 and 1910. Designed to support a water pitcher and washing basin, it features a water-resistant marble surface, wooden cabinet storage, and often a mirrored superstructure or tiled splashback.

Edwardian washstands were commonly constructed using hardwoods such as walnut, mahogany, or oak, often finished with decorative burr veneers. The tops were predominantly fitted with thick slabs of natural marble, accompanied by ceramic tiled backs, brass hardware, and glass mirrors.

Authentic Edwardian washstands typically demonstrate lighter proportions and simpler decorative motifs compared to heavier Victorian predecessors. Common indicators include dovetail drawer joints, original brass handles or drop pulls, ceramic castors, and period-correct marble tops with natural veining and minor edge wear.

Antique washstands are frequently converted into functional modern bathroom vanities by plumbing a basin into the marble surface. Alternatively, they serve as unique hallway consoles or dining room sideboards, providing both surface display space and concealed cupboard storage.

Maintain the wood frame by dusting with a soft cloth and periodically applying a quality beeswax polish along the grain. Clean the marble top using pH-neutral soap and warm water, avoiding acidic cleaning chemicals or abrasive sponges that can etch the stone surface.
